V. Ya. Yuriev popup.description2 Study Object – process of spring triticale breeding. Purpose – development of spring triticale lines and varieties with high grain yield, adaptability and technological quality. Methods – breeding: hybridization, selection; analysis: ontogenetic, laboratory, mathematical and statistical. Theoretical and Practical Results - Hybridization designs and cross combinations providing breeding material with high productivity, resistance to bio- and abiotic factors have been outlined. Two spring triticale varieties, which are characterized by high abiotic adaptability and yield capacity, have been developed and submitted for the state registration. Spring grain triticale variety Kripost Kharkivska is highly resistant to lodging (9 score), resistant to pathogens (7-8 points) and drought (7-8 points). The average yield is 4.32 t/ha. The potential yield is 8.5 t/ha. Spring triticale variety Opora Kharkivska shows an increased lodging resistance (8 points). The average yield is 4.49 t/ha. The total bread-making index is 7.5 – 8.0. Twelve breeding lines, which are of complex value, have been produced. These lines are sources of lodging resistance and high grain yield capacity. Novelty - New varieties have no analogues in terms of combination of agricultural characteristics: high yield capacity, lodging resistance, cold tolerance. Their yields are higher than those from registered varieties. Implementation efficiency - Increased adaptability of varieties will contribute to expansion and rationalization of agricultural area using and to stabilization of the grain production in Ukraine.
